Jeffrey H. Lynford
Jeffrey H. Lynford is a financier, philanthropist and civic leader from New York currently serving as president and CEO of and as vice chairman of The Port Authority of New York and New Jersey. He was the co-founder of the Wellsford group of public and private companies and has served as chairman of three exchange-listed corporations which were taken public during his tenure. He has served on the boards of three institutions of higher learning: New York University, NYU Tandon School of Engineering, and the School of Public and International Affairs at Princeton University.
Career
Lynford has co-founded the following firms:- Wellsford Residential Property Trust served as chairman from 1992 to 1997
- Wellsford Real Properties, Inc. served as chairman from 1997 to 2007
- Reis, Inc. served as chairman from 2007 to 2010
- Wellsford Strategic Partners LLC

Personal
He is married to Tondra Lynford; they have four children and two grandchildren.Philanthropy
Lynford is the grantor of the Lynford Family Charitable Trust which has supported hundreds of not-for-profit organizations since its inception in 1984.The Trust - which focuses its giving in the areas of education and health, historic preservation, performing and visual arts, and public policy - has endowed the following fellowships,, Lynford-Chudnovsky Fellowship at NYU Tandon School of Engineering, and . Further, the Lynford Family Charitable Trust sponsors the NYU Tandon School of Engineering Lynford Lecture Series, an annual presentation of the work of exceptional mathematicians, engineers, and scientists.
